Does anyone know how to interrupt the lookup of an integer value? I
know I need to subclass int, since builtin types can't be altered
directly...

Below is how far I've come... What I want is to tap into the access of
instance i's value 1...

>>> class Int(int):
	def __init__(self, *a, **k):
		super(Int, self).__init__(self, *a, **k)

		
>>> i = Int(1)
>>> i
1
